#f1c2e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1c2e1 is composed of 94.5% red, 76.1%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.5% magenta, 6.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 85.3%. #f1c2e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e385c3.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f1c2e1 color description : Light grayish pink.
#f1c2e1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1c2e1 has RGB values of R:241, G:194,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.07,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15844065.

Shades and Tints of #f1c2e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1c2e1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dad9da is the less saturated color, while #fdb6e5 is the most saturated one.
